Qiskit Textbook

The Qiskit Textbook is a free digital open source textbook that will teach the concepts of quantum computing while you learn to use Qiskit.

Introduction Course

This introduction course is around 3 hours long and will take individuals from all backgrounds through a linear path of content that begins at the atoms of computation and ends at Grover's algorithm.

Coding with Qiskit

This video series starts at learning how to install Qiskit locally, understanding what gates to do quantum states and explores quantum algorithms and the latest research topics.
